EiDF Solar has reached an agreement with the IKAV investment fund, through its IEI II Global Infrastructure Investments vehicle, to finance 30 solar farms with a combined capacity of 48MW.
These are the first parks to be launched by Spanish solar developer EiDF.
Under the agreement, IKAV will contribute a total of €13m as an investment partner of EiDF Generación.
EiDF strengthened its generation unit last year to accelerate its vertical integration plans based on the complementing of three activities: self-consumption, generation and marketing.
The energy produced in the parks built and operated by EiDF will be used for its commercialisation area, reinforced after the acquisition of ODF Energía.
The company’s portfolio of generation projects exceeds 1000MW.
However, it continues to analyse investment opportunities that allow it to expand its pipeline with other projects at an advanced stage of development, EiDF said.
